2017-02-08 5 views
3

나는 클라우드 형성을 통해 S3 버킷을 생성하고 SSE 버켓 정책 (Amazon S3 관리 키가있는 서버 측 암호화)을 할당했습니다. 객체에 x-aws-server-side-encryption이 설정된 AWS cli를 통해 S3 버킷에 객체를 업로드하는 방법은 무엇입니까? 예를 들어 주시면 감사하겠습니다.aws s3 버킷 암호화

답변

6

S3와 상호 작용하는 데 사용하는 툴이나 SDK는 언급하지 않았습니다. 서버 측 암호화 플래그가 설정 S3에 파일을 복사 할 AWS CLI tool를 사용하려면

aws s3 cp <local path> <s3 path> --sse AES256

당신이 그런 KMS 키와 같은 다른 암호화 키를 지정하는 데 사용할 수있는 다른 -sse 옵션이 있습니다.

+0

고맙습니다. 내가 찾는 완벽한 답. – Aty

+3

안녕하세요 @Aty,이 대답이나 질문에 대한 답변이 있으면 [확인] (http://meta.stackexchange.com/q/5234/179419)을 클릭하여 확인하십시오. 이는 해결책을 찾았으며 응답자와 자신에게 어느 정도의 평판을 제공한다는 것을 더 넓은 커뮤니티에 나타냅니다. 이를 수행 할 의무는 없습니다. –